Output d818810abd8dfb13ddf196503a1e76d9eda7a2aad0e46b6f7151ab6caaccce2f:6

value
291097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f512143739fcf43462eb408362bc556cc5118d71 OP_EQUAL
address
3Q2q8h2TDTJcE6krUv12vtumwEANEdRFGC
transaction
d818810abd8dfb13ddf196503a1e76d9eda7a2aad0e46b6f7151ab6caaccce2f
confirmations
166849
spent
true